Introduction to Memorial Hall of the Zhaojin Shan-Gan-Bian Revolutionary Base Area

Zhaogin Memorial Hall is located in Zhaogin Town, Yaozhou District, Tongchuan City, Shaanxi Province, and is a department-level institution under the Organization Department of the Tongchuan Municipal Committee. The memorial hall was first built and opened in 2004, and Qi Xin, the wife of Comrade Xi Zhongxun, attended the opening ceremony and wrote an inscription: “ Inherit the legacy of our forefathers and build the old revolutionary area.”

Introduction to the History of the Shanxi-Gansu Border Revolutionary Base Area

Red Zhaojin is more than 40 kilometers northwest of Tongchuan New District in Shaanxi Province, it is located at the border of three counties, namely Tongchuan Yaoxian, Xianyang Xunyi County and Chunhua County, it is next to the ZIiwu Ridge in the north, the south overlooking the Weibei Plateau, it is next to the Xianyu Street in the east, the west is next to the Shan-Gan hinterland, Surrounded by mountains and ravines, it is a unique area for guerrilla warfare activities. In the early 1930s, Liu Zhidan, Xie Zichang, Xi Zhongxun and other proletarian revolutionaries of the old generation threw their heads and spilled their blood here, and in the spring of 1933, they opened up a red armed area of about 2,500 square kilometers, centering on Zhaogin and spanning five counties, namely, Yaoxian, Xunyi, Chunhua, Yijun, and Tongguan, and it became the first mountainous revolutionary base area in the north of China.
